Double medal chances for Portugal and Spain at Nazaré 2016

Portugal have a bold dream and that is winning three-time EURO gold on just one day. While the nation's football team play the UEFA EURO final on Sunday night in Paris, the women's as well men's under 16 beach handball team are also close to the medal ranks as they reached the semi-finals at Nazaré 2016 on Saturday.

The second nation to still have two teams left in the event is Spain, making the two countries from the Iberian peninsula the dominating forces at the Under 16 Beach Handball EURO in Nazaré.

In the men's event Portugal faced Switzerland in the quarter-final and eased past them with a convincing 2:0 win; Spain followed suit, beating Germany also 2:0.

Russia needed the shoot-out to get rid of Greece, 2:1, while Italy beat Poland 2:0. In the semi-finals at 10:00 hrs local time Portugal face Italy and Russia play against Spain.

In the women's event Portugal as well as Spain needed the shoot-out to win their respective games. Portugal had lost the first set to Hungary 23:16, but then won the second 20:18 and the shoot-out 6:4.

Spain had taken the first set 10:5 against Germany, lost the second 15:11, but then won the shoot-out 7:4. Norway (against Croatia) and the Netherlands (against Italy) recorded 2:0 wins each to reach the semis.

On Sunday at 10:00 hrs local time Norway face Netherlands and Portugal play against Spain.

The finals will take place at 16:00 hrs local time in the women's event and at 17:00 hrs local time in the men's event.

Comprehensive coverage

Over the three days of the tournament, the EHF offers all beach handball fans plenty of opportunities to follow the event.

All matches of Court 1 and Court 2 will be streamed live on the ehfTV Youtube channel. This coverage will be supplemented by a number of highlight and best of-clips from the event which will also be available on Youtube as well as on the beach handball Facebook page.

All matches can be followed with the dedicated beach handball ticker and the respective statistics are available for all men's and all women's teams on the respective event pages.

Furthermore there will be continious updates on the EHF live Twitter account, the EHF Beach Handball Instagram channel and the EHF's Snapchat account, ehf_live.
